Progressive Care Nurse Salary Guide: Chesterfield, MO

Average Progressive Care Nurse Salary

$31.73/hour

The average salary for a Progressive Care Nurse in Chesterfield, MO is $31.73 per hour. This is 37% lower than the Missouri average of $43.32.

Estimate based on Bureau of Labor Statistics data.
